Like any other business York is no different. Its about making money. Vendors spend thousands of dollars to attend that meet. Things like employee salaries, table rent, food, lodging, snacks/coffee, travel expenses all enter into the equation. If a vendor cannot turn a decent profit they will not continue to attend. The Eastern Division is just reacting to the amount of member admissions and table rental revenues. If the days that the meet is open are scaled back it only means that the demand in not there.  Some hobbyists like myself also stopped attending as the cost of the total experience was not worth the reward. Now figure in the effects of online buying and the changing demographics of those that buy the trains.  All these factors will continue to have a significant impact , on a closed door meet that discourages family participation and targets only a specific customer.
